Browse All Jobs

Tide is seeking a Staff Backend Engineer to join its Developer Productivity team. This role focuses on empowering developers by streamlining workflows, maintaining internal tools, upgrading dependencies, enhancing CI/CD pipelines, and implementing coding standards. The ideal candidate will have extensive experience in software engineering, CI/CD pipeline optimization, and DevOps practices.

The Staff Backend Engineer will be based in Serbia and will work within the Developer Productivity team.

Role Involves:

  • Leading optimization of CI/CD pipelines and dependency upgrades.
  • Managing and improving internal libraries and contribution workflows.
  • Developing tools and automation for code quality.
  • Collaborating with cross-functional teams to resolve productivity bottlenecks.
  • Establishing best practices in coding, testing, and deployment.
  • Mentoring junior engineers and fostering continuous improvement.
  • Analyzing and optimizing engineering workflows.
  • Staying current with emerging technologies.

Requirements:

  • 7+ years in software engineering with a focus on developer productivity, CI/CD, tooling, or infrastructure.
  • Expertise in designing CI/CD pipelines using tools like Jenkins, GitHub Actions, or GitLab CI.
  • Proficiency in programming languages (Java, Python, JavaScript) and frameworks like Spring Boot.
  • Understanding of code quality tools and their integration into workflows.
  • Knowledge of DevOps practices, including containerization (Docker, Kubernetes) and cloud platforms (AWS, Azure, GCP).
  • Independent problem-solving skills and the ability to drive initiatives.
  • Strong communication skills to mentor junior engineers.
  • Experience with internal libraries, versioning, and dependency management.
  • Passion for continuous learning and adopting new technologies.

What Tide Offers:

  • 25 days paid annual leave
  • 3 paid days off for volunteering or L&D activities
  • Personal L&D budget in the amount of 500 EUR per year
  • Mental wellbeing platform Plum
  • Share options
Apply

Careers at Tide

Tide is a rapidly expanding finance platform dedicated to saving small businesses time and money. It provides business accounts, banking services, and connected administrative solutions like invoicing and accounting. Serving over 1 million small businesses globally, Tide operates in the UK, India, and Germany. Headquartered in London, with offices in Sofia, Hyderabad, Delhi, Berlin and Belgrade, the company fosters a transparent and inclusive environment. Tide embraces diversity and is committed to building products that resonate with the diverse needs of its members.